We explored the relative importance of ecosystem diversity, socioeconomic, environmental, and geographical factors in determining the pattern and diversity of people’s plant use in Ecuador, based on existing ethnobotanic investigations and a large database of georeferenced plant collections. For each of 40 communities, we determined the number of plants used and their distribution among 12 use categories. Plant species richness of the ecosystem surrounding each village was determined using herbarium data and rarefaction. Variation in socioeconomic, environmental, and geographical indicator variables at the community level was summarized using Principal Component Analysis (PCA). Data were then analyzed using multiple regression and ordination... |

Aflatoxins production is affected by abiotic, biotic and genetic parameters. Eugenesic and dysgenetic condition for aflatoxinogenesis are relatively well studied, such as: the influence of temperature, pH, Aw, Oxigen tension, osmotic pression, organic and inorganic nutrients, substance with fungistatic effects: however there are relatively few knowledge about endogenous regulator mechanisms, the kinetic of the anabolism and the interaction between the productive moulds and remaining microflora holding in eutrophying substrates. The main objective of this study is to evaluate biotic interaction between five indigenous strains of A. flavus, confirmed non-toxigenic, and a productive strain (A. parasiticus ATCC 15 517), cultured simultaneously on two... |
